Choosing the best products for a new roof in this area requires a deep understanding of regional conditions. Many citizens go with metal roofing, especially high quality steel that has been dealt with to withstand rust. This is a popular option since it offers a sleek modern aesthetic while supplying extraordinary resistance to the sea spray that can damage lower products. Metal is also lightweight and exceptional for water collection, which is a reward for those who make use of rainwater tanks. On the other hand, concrete and terracotta tiles stay a staple of the regional landscape. They offer outstanding thermal mass, assisting to keep homes cooler throughout the sweltering heat of January. Nevertheless, the weight of these tiles means that the underlying structure must be in leading condition. An expert assessment is always the first step in figuring out which product will serve a particular home finest for the next thirty or forty years.
The roof replacement process on the Central Coast typically begins with an extensive assessment of the website. A professional will evaluate the condition of the roof's underlying structure, including the battens, sarking, and wood frame, to identify any damage triggered by years of water direct exposure, such as rot or compromised assistances. After establishing a strategy to address these concerns, the existing here roof material is thoroughly removed and dealt with in an environmentally accountable way. This stage of the task can be the most difficult, as it leaves the house momentarily exposed to the components. To alleviate this threat, reputable local contractors closely track weather forecasts to arrange the work throughout a duration of dry weather, and they utilize durable tarps to shield the interior of your home from the aspects. A key benefit of a complete replacement, often ignored, is the possibility to enhance a home's energy efficiency. Lots of older homes are deficient in sufficient insulation and modern ventilation systems. This replacement process provides an ideal chance to incorporate premium insulation products, such as anticon blankets or reflective foil sarking, which successfully obstruct radiant heat and significantly reduce the need for a/c during summer season. Furthermore, the incorporation of whirling ventilators or ridge vents promotes air flow within the roof space, avoiding mould accumulation and shielding ceiling joists from wetness damage. Provided the ongoing concern of rising energy costs for Australian homes, these improvements eventually yield long-term cost savings through minimized energy bills and a more comfy living environment.
When embarking on a significant job, prioritizing security and adherence to guidelines is important. In New South Wales, strict guidelines determine the proper treatments for roofing jobs, including fall defense and the safe disposal of dangerous substances, such as asbestos. Hiring a qualified, guaranteed expert warranties compliance with current building standards, protecting the home's structural strength. This method also uses property owners reassurance through material and workmanship service warranties. While a low-cost, unlicensed option may be tempting, the potential consequences of water damage or insurance disagreements considerably outweigh any initial expense savings. A reliable specialist will offer a comprehensive price quote and a transparent task schedule, getting rid of unexpected issues once the remodelling begins.
